site stats

Django jwt token存在哪里

WebMay 4, 2024 · JSON Web Token is an open standard for securely transferring data within parties using a JSON object. JWT is used for stateless authentication mechanisms for … WebNov 1, 2024 · 详解Django配置JWT认证方式. 1. 安装 rest_framework + djangorestframework_simplejwt. djangorestframework_simplejwt 是提供 jwt 的 django 应用。. 2. 配置好 rest_framework 后,settings.py 里加上以下内容以支持 jwt认证. REST_FRAMEWORK = { 'DEFAULT_AUTHENTICATION_CLASSES': [ …

FullStack JWT Auth: User serializers, Views, and Endpoints

WebJul 10, 2024 · drf项目的jwt认证开发流程. """ 1)用账号密码访问登录接口,登录接口逻辑中调用 签发token 算法,得到token,返回给客户端,客户端自己存到cookies中 2)校验token的算法应该写在认证类中 (在认证类中调用),全局配置给认证组件,所有视图类请求,都会进行认证 ... WebApr 27, 2024 · 二.基于Django实现普通token校验. 普通token校验过程原理如下:. 注意点 :. 普通token校验,在用户登录生产token后,服务端会把token存在数据库中,这一点和后续要介绍的jwt有明显区别. Django中普通token校验功能实现如下:. 1 .项目整体结构如下. 其中,define_token这个 ... bump in the night cbt https://robertsbrothersllc.com

JWT Authentication with Django REST Framework - GeeksforGeeks

WebJan 22, 2024 · Django要兼容session认证的方式,还需要同时支持JWT,并且两种验证需要共用同一套权限系统,该如何处理呢?. 我们可以参考Django的解决方案:装饰器,例 … WebJun 15, 2024 · 使用django-rest-framework开发api并使用json web token进行身份验证 在这里使用django-rest-framework-jwt这个库来帮助我们简单的使用jwt进行身份验证 并解决 … WebMay 2, 2024 · Django+JWT实现Token认证. 对外提供API不用django rest framework(DRF)就是旁门左道吗?. 基于Token的鉴权机制越来越多的用在了项目 … bump in the night chloe

django - Validate and get the user using the jwt token inside a …

Category:Django REST Framework教程(7): 如何使用JWT认证(神文多图)

Tags:Django jwt token存在哪里

Django jwt token存在哪里

django - Validate and get the user using the jwt token inside a …

WebAug 7, 2024 · First of all I assume you understand and able to created a basic Django project. ... Great, we just implemented the basic infrastructure for our RESTful API and now we’re going to implement jwt auth and using google token for authentication. Let’s install django-rest-framework-simplejwt $ pip install djangorestframework_simplejwt. WebOct 13, 2024 · Using JWT authentication in Django; JSON Web Token ... A header is a JSON object which declares that the encoded object is a JWT token which is MACed …

Django jwt token存在哪里

Did you know?

WebMar 27, 2024 · 基于django框架的cookie,session,token认证方式. HTTP协议本身是”无状态”的,在一次请求和下一次请求之间没有任何状态保持,服务器无法识别来自同一用户的连续请求。. 有了cookie和session、token,服务器就可以利用它们记录客户端的访问状态了,这样用户就不用在 ...

WebDRF本身框架的用户认证模块提供了三种用户认证方法, Authentication 1. BasicAuthentication 2. TokenAuthentication 3. SessionAuthentication 但是对于需要前后端分离的场景来说,3不适合,2又不好用也不够用,JSON Web Token也许是个很不错的替代品,安全加密功夫做得比较足,而且工作原理也清楚明了,使用也简单。 WebDec 15, 2024 · 相对于 session 方案, JWT 会生成一个 token 而不是 session_id。. 与 session 方案不同的是。. JWT 生成的 token, 不需要在后端存储任何东西。. JWT 的理 …

WebOct 20, 2024 · token = RefreshToken (Rtoken) token.blacklist () return Response ("Successful Logout", status=status.HTTP_200_OK) Here the user access token is sent in the Header as “Authorization” parameter ... WebSep 15, 2024 · I am using django-rest-framework for the REST API. Also, for JSON web token authentication I am using django-rest-framework-jwt.After a successful login, the user is provided with a token. I have found how to verify a token with the api call, but is there any way to validate the token inside a view and get the user of that token, similar …

WebSep 23, 2024 · 使用django-rest-framework开发api并使用json web token进行身份验证 在这里使用django-rest-framework-jwt这个库来帮助我们简单的使用jwt进行身份验证 并解决一些前后端分离而产生的跨域问题. 流程 安装 安装django-rest-framework. 现在接口一般都是restful风格,所以我们直接使用这个 ...

WebServer authenticated the client request, generates a jwt token with a validity period and user association, and responds to client and includes the fresh token. Client stores the jwt token in cache, whenever it needs to authenticate again it sends the jwt token instead of credentials. If the jwt token was received by server within the validity ... bump in the night charactersWebJun 1, 2024 · Here is a solution. Override the AnonymousUser's is_authenticated property and you are good to go. from django.contrib.auth.models import AnonymousUser class ServerUser (AnonymousUser): @property def is_authenticated (self): # Always return True. This is a way to tell if # the user has been authenticated in permissions return True. half baked harvest ground chicken recipesWebJWT_PUBLIC_KEY. This is an object of type cryptography.hazmat.primitives.asymmetric.rsa.RSAPublicKey. It will be used to verify the signature of the incoming JWT. Will override JWT_SECRET_KEY when set. Read the documentation for more details. Please note that JWT_ALGORITHM must be set to one … half baked harvest ground chickenWebDec 26, 2024 · Step 1: Create a virtual environment and activate it. Step 2: Install Django and start your project. Step 3: Create a project named TokenAuth. django-adminb … half baked harvest halloumiWebAug 8, 2024 · 而符合DRF 的JWT 框架, 默认使用的是 Django 自带的账户系统做的。 所以再 OAuth2 和 JWT 结合需要做点工作。 OAuth2认证方法. 此步骤主要包含, 从资源服 … half baked harvest ground turkeyWebNov 23, 2024 · Django REST framework JWT提供了登录获取token的视图,可以直接使用. 在子路由中, 配置路由: from rest_framework_jwt.views import obtain_jwt_token … half baked harvest ham and bean soupWebJun 15, 2024 · 使用django-rest-framework开发api并使用json web token进行身份验证 在这里使用django-rest-framework-jwt这个库来帮助我们简单的使用jwt进行身份验证 并解决一些前后端分离而产生的跨域问题. 流程 安装 安装django-rest-framework. 现在接口一般都是restful风格,所以我们直接使用这个 ... half baked harvest ham and cheese